The Executive Certificate in Wildlife Conservation Economics and Finance provides professionals with a comprehensive understanding of the financial mechanisms crucial for effective wildlife conservation. This specialized program equips participants with practical skills in fundraising, budgeting, financial modeling, and impact assessment within the conservation sector.
Learning outcomes include mastering financial planning and management techniques specifically tailored to conservation projects, developing robust fundraising strategies to secure funding from diverse sources (philanthropy, government, corporate), and effectively evaluating the financial sustainability and impact of conservation initiatives. Graduates demonstrate proficiency in applying economic principles to conservation challenges, such as biodiversity valuation and cost-benefit analysis.
The program's duration is typically structured to accommodate working professionals, often ranging from several months to a year, delivered through a blended learning approach combining online modules and intensive workshops. This flexible format ensures accessibility while maintaining a rigorous academic standard. The curriculum integrates case studies and real-world examples, ensuring practical application of learned concepts.
